Ali & Ava is a quietly powerful film directed by Clio Barnard, exploring the complexities of human connection. Set in a vivid, contemporary British landscape, it's a character-driven piece that relies on nuanced performances, particularly from the leads. The chemistry between Ali and Ava feels organic, reflecting a genuine warmth amid their individual struggles. The pacing allows for moments of reflection, punctuated by the vibrancy of their interaction with Sofia, which adds depth to their bond. The cinematography captures the atmosphere beautifully, enveloping the viewer in its emotional nuances. It's not just a romance; it's a meditation on loneliness, companionship, and the challenge of opening up. The practical effects are minimal, but the authenticity of the setting speaks volumes about the characters' lives.
